RFID 13.56 MHz is not a specific brand but a frequency standard used in Radio Frequency Identification (RFID) technology. It is widely adopted by global companies like NXP Semiconductors (Netherlands), Texas Instruments (USA), and STMicroelectronics (Switzerland). These brands provide RFID solutions for industries such as logistics, retail, healthcare, and manufacturing. Key products include RFID tags, readers, and chips, enabling asset tracking, inventory management, and contactless payments. The 13.56 MHz frequency is ISO/IEC 15693 and ISO/IEC 14443 compliant, ensuring interoperability across systems.
